The income tax withholding formula for the State of Oregon includes the following changes: The standard deduction amount for Single filers claiming less than three allowances has changed from $2,420 to $2,605. The standard deduction amount for Single filers claiming three or more allowances has changed from $4,840 to … WebMar 14, 2024 · A W-4 tells your employer how much tax to withhold from your paycheck. ... Web42.17.131 EMPLOYEE'S WITHHOLDING ALLOWANCES (1) For purposes of determining the employee's withholding allowances and withholding exemptions, the department provides Form MW-4. The department has determined that the federal child tax credit that allows extra allowances for federal withholding is not allowed for Montana purposes when … WebApr 11, 2024 · Summary. Video of the Day. home for rent boise idWebthe number of withholding allowances you are entitled to claim. However, you may claim fewer allowances than this. Two Earners/Two Jobs. If you have a working spouse or more than one job, figure the total number of allowances you are entitled to claim on all jobs using worksheets from only one W-4. This total should be divided among all jobs. home for rent bramptonhome for rent bad credit seagoville tx
